Paralegal (Clinical Negligence – Liverpool)

Location: Liverpool/Hybrid

Fletchers Group is seeking a motivated and detail-oriented Paralegal to join our Clinical Negligence team in Liverpool.

As a Paralegal, you will support solicitors in managing Clinical Negligence cases from inception to trial, under supervision. Your responsibilities include legal research, drafting documents, liaising with clients and professionals, and assisting in case settlement.

Main Responsibilities:

  • Meet KPI targets
  • Progress cases efficiently
  • Liaise with clients, experts, and other professionals
  • Handle pre and post-issue procedures
  • Complete actions on Proclaim Action List
  • Accurate time recording
  • Maintain client files in accordance with quality standards
  • Assist in medical record collection and client document preparation
  • Manage a caseload of early-stage Clinical Negligence cases
